Dominique Ferguson

Top Recruit Heading to Florida International

Early in his high school career, Dominique Ferguson was projected as the type of player that could land at a top program, play for a year or two and then make the jump to the NBA. He may still reach the next level -- but the route he'll travel looks a little different today. On August 7, 2009, he became the first big-time recruit to sign with Isiah Thomas at Florida International.

A 6'8", 200-pound combo forward, Ferguson is ranked as the eighth-best recruit in the class of 2010 by ESPN/Scouts Inc. and 23rd by Rivals. Though his Summer 2009 play has received generally lukewarm reviews from scouts, Ferguson was still drawing interest from the biggest of the big-time programs; Kentucky, Duke, Indiana, UCLA and Arizona, among others, were involved before his surprising commitment to the Golden Panthers. He'll finish out his high school career at Hargrave Military Academy in Chatham, Virginia.

Size and athleticism are his strengths. He runs the floor well, and has the ability to spot-up for a jumper off the break or drive to the rim and finish. His decision-making can be suspect; though he has a good handle, especially for his size, he can over-dribble or be forced into bad shots. On defense, he has the size to defend fours and the agility to play out on the wing.

He's a talented-enough player to make a real contribution in one of the top conferences. In the Sun Belt, he should dominate.

Fast Facts

Name: Dominique Ferguson
Position: Forward
Height: 6'8"
Weight: 200
High School: Hargrave Military Academy (Chatham, VA)
College Choice: Florida International (Verbal)
